Significance of Database Indexes in SQL Server



Understanding the importance of index structures in SQL Server is essential for efficient database performance.
Here are key points to keep in mind:


  • Index structures significantly enhance data retrieval speed.

  • Properly tuned indexes minimize search times.

  • Index fragmentation may negatively impact performance.

  • Consistent monitoring of indexes is vital.

  • Choosing the appropriate indexing method is key.

Successful SQL Server Index Optimization Techniques



Excelling in SQL Server Index Tuning involves various techniques.
To begin with, recognizing commonly queried fields is key.
Developing multi-column indexes may boost query performance substantially.
Furthermore, periodic index rebuilding assists in minimizing fragmentation.
